Output fa8a34980edeec8ef0f0e9c19fe1aa0345f4fd04609a921830d3b121104c0693:11

value
70532168
script pubkey
OP_HASH160 OP_PUSHBYTES_20 42bc0216addd5c76f338aedd6d522a4b5aa12c13 OP_EQUAL
address
MDz248K25PcDptiCPMSWxfarQbeCXairxp
transaction
fa8a34980edeec8ef0f0e9c19fe1aa0345f4fd04609a921830d3b121104c0693
spent
true